Synopsis "transgender nation"
In the United States we are bombarded with gender propaganda that supports a repressive dual gender system pitting the genders against each other. Transgenderists as gender nonconformists challenge us to rethink traditional discourses on sex and gender. Transgender Nation investigates the male-to-woman transgenderist and transsexual from a sociocultural and sociopolitical perspective maintaining that it is not the individual transgenderist who is sick and in need of treatment but rather the culture that must be treated.
